Breastfeeding – 4 Day Old After Tongue-tie Release With Compressions


Breastfeeding – 4 Day Old After Tongue-tie Release With Compressions The baby just had a tongue tie release. The mother is doing compressions appropriately. She waits to see if the baby is drinking or not (pause in the chin). If the baby is not drinking, she compresses, holds the compression until the baby stops sucking or stops drinking and then releases. Breastfeeding – Baby 28 Hours Old Assisted Latching


Breastfeeding – Baby 28 Hours Old Assisted Latching Shows latching on. Not perfect, but good enough. The mother had no pain. It did take two tries to get the baby to latch on, but thats okay; theres no point in trying to force a baby who does not take the breast to stay on the breast. It wont work. Note the baby has an asymmetric latch, with the chin touching the breast, the nose not touching the breast, and he covers more of the areola with his lower lip…

Breastfeeding – Really Good Drinking


This baby is drinking very well at the breast. The pause in the chin as the baby opens his mouth to the maximum, just before closing his mouth, indicates his mouth is filling up with milk; the longer the pause, the more milk the baby is taking in. Thus, it is obvious that the advice to feed the baby 20 minutes (10 minutes, 30 minutes, whatever) on each makes no sense. Breastfeeding – Nibbling


Nibbling This baby is eight weeks old and is doing almost no drinking, though very occasionally one sees a short pause in the baby’s chin. A baby who breastfeeds only with this type of sucking could stay on the breast for hours and still not get enough milk. Something needs to be done here and if achieving a better latch, using compression doesnt help, the baby almost certainly needs to be supplemented. Breastfeeding – Jiggling & Pulling Due To Low Breast Milk Flow


This is an older baby, about 3 or 4 months of age, whose mother’s breast milk production has decreased. Following Early Good Weight Gain by the mother, for some reasons this decrease in milk production might occur. Some of the reasons that may result in a decreased milk production include the mother’s usage of a hormonal birth control method (including hormone releasing intrauterine devices or intra-vaginal hormone releasing rings). Breastfeeding – Baby 28 hrs old, Baby-Led Mother-Guided Latching


Breastfeeding – Baby 28 hrs old, Baby-Led Mother-Guided Latching The baby starts searching for the breast. The mother guides him towards the nipple. The baby opens up fairly wide, but the mother does not bring the baby on as well as she could and the baby has a shallow latch. He should have more of the breast in his mouth.
